Colorado Springs is 9% cheaper than Henderson.
When comparing Colorado Springs, CO and Henderson, NV, the overall cost of living indices are 119 and 131 respectively (national median = 100). Rent is $188/month cheaper in Colorado Springs, saving renters about $2,256/year.
Median household income is $5,456/year higher in Henderson. Home values also differ significantly — the median in Colorado Springs is $420,700 compared to $465,000 in Henderson.
Nevada has no state income tax, giving Henderson residents a significant tax advantage over Colorado's 4.4% rate.
